/scripts/dtc/libfdt/ |
D | fdt.c | 77 const void *fdt_offset_ptr(const void *fdt, int offset, unsigned int len) in fdt_offset_ptr() argument 79 unsigned absoffset = offset + fdt_off_dt_struct(fdt); in fdt_offset_ptr() 81 if ((absoffset < offset) in fdt_offset_ptr() 87 if (((offset + len) < offset) in fdt_offset_ptr() 88 || ((offset + len) > fdt_size_dt_struct(fdt))) in fdt_offset_ptr() 91 return _fdt_offset_ptr(fdt, offset); in fdt_offset_ptr() 98 int offset = startoffset; in fdt_next_tag() local 102 tagp = fdt_offset_ptr(fdt, offset, FDT_TAGSIZE); in fdt_next_tag() 106 offset += FDT_TAGSIZE; in fdt_next_tag() 113 p = fdt_offset_ptr(fdt, offset++, 1); in fdt_next_tag() [all …]
|
D | fdt_ro.c | 58 static int _fdt_nodename_eq(const void *fdt, int offset, in _fdt_nodename_eq() argument 61 const char *p = fdt_offset_ptr(fdt, offset + FDT_TAGSIZE, len+1); in _fdt_nodename_eq() 94 int offset; in fdt_get_max_phandle() local 96 for (offset = fdt_next_node(fdt, -1, NULL);; in fdt_get_max_phandle() 97 offset = fdt_next_node(fdt, offset, NULL)) { in fdt_get_max_phandle() 100 if (offset == -FDT_ERR_NOTFOUND) in fdt_get_max_phandle() 103 if (offset < 0) in fdt_get_max_phandle() 106 phandle = fdt_get_phandle(fdt, offset); in fdt_get_max_phandle() 134 static int _nextprop(const void *fdt, int offset) in _nextprop() argument 140 tag = fdt_next_tag(fdt, offset, &nextoffset); in _nextprop() [all …]
|
D | fdt_sw.c | 75 int offset = fdt_size_dt_struct(fdt); in _fdt_grab_space() local 81 if ((offset + len < offset) || (offset + len > spaceleft)) in _fdt_grab_space() 84 fdt_set_size_dt_struct(fdt, offset + len); in _fdt_grab_space() 85 return _fdt_offset_ptr_w(fdt, offset); in _fdt_grab_space() 145 int offset; in fdt_add_reservemap_entry() local 152 offset = fdt_off_dt_struct(fdt); in fdt_add_reservemap_entry() 153 if ((offset + sizeof(*re)) > fdt_totalsize(fdt)) in fdt_add_reservemap_entry() 156 re = (struct fdt_reserve_entry *)((char *)fdt + offset); in fdt_add_reservemap_entry() 160 fdt_set_off_dt_struct(fdt, offset + sizeof(*re)); in fdt_add_reservemap_entry() 206 int struct_top, offset; in _fdt_find_add_string() local [all …]
|
D | libfdt_internal.h | 65 int _fdt_check_node_offset(const void *fdt, int offset); 66 int _fdt_check_prop_offset(const void *fdt, int offset); 70 static inline const void *_fdt_offset_ptr(const void *fdt, int offset) in _fdt_offset_ptr() argument 72 return (const char *)fdt + fdt_off_dt_struct(fdt) + offset; in _fdt_offset_ptr() 75 static inline void *_fdt_offset_ptr_w(void *fdt, int offset) in _fdt_offset_ptr_w() argument 77 return (void *)(uintptr_t)_fdt_offset_ptr(fdt, offset); in _fdt_offset_ptr_w()
|
D | fdt_wip.c | 118 int _fdt_node_end_offset(void *fdt, int offset) in _fdt_node_end_offset() argument 122 while ((offset >= 0) && (depth >= 0)) in _fdt_node_end_offset() 123 offset = fdt_next_node(fdt, offset, &depth); in _fdt_node_end_offset() 125 return offset; in _fdt_node_end_offset()
|
D | libfdt.h | 147 const void *fdt_offset_ptr(const void *fdt, int offset, unsigned int checklen); 149 static inline void *fdt_offset_ptr_w(void *fdt, int offset, int checklen) in fdt_offset_ptr_w() argument 151 return (void *)(uintptr_t)fdt_offset_ptr(fdt, offset, checklen); in fdt_offset_ptr_w() 154 uint32_t fdt_next_tag(const void *fdt, int offset, int *nextoffset); 160 int fdt_next_node(const void *fdt, int offset, int *depth); 169 int fdt_first_subnode(const void *fdt, int offset); 182 int fdt_next_subnode(const void *fdt, int offset); 490 int fdt_next_property_offset(const void *fdt, int offset); 544 int offset, 635 const void *fdt_getprop_by_offset(const void *fdt, int offset,
|
D | fdt_rw.c | 337 int offset, nextoffset; in fdt_add_subnode_namelen() local 345 offset = fdt_subnode_offset_namelen(fdt, parentoffset, name, namelen); in fdt_add_subnode_namelen() 346 if (offset >= 0) in fdt_add_subnode_namelen() 348 else if (offset != -FDT_ERR_NOTFOUND) in fdt_add_subnode_namelen() 349 return offset; in fdt_add_subnode_namelen() 354 offset = nextoffset; in fdt_add_subnode_namelen() 355 tag = fdt_next_tag(fdt, offset, &nextoffset); in fdt_add_subnode_namelen() 358 nh = _fdt_offset_ptr_w(fdt, offset); in fdt_add_subnode_namelen() 371 return offset; in fdt_add_subnode_namelen()
|
/scripts/ |
D | faddr2line | 101 local offset=${func_addr#*+} 102 offset=${offset%/*} 106 if [[ -z $func ]] || [[ -z $offset ]] || [[ $func = $func_addr ]]; then 131 local addr=$(($sym_base + $offset)) 133 warn "bad address: $sym_base + $offset" 154 if [[ $offset -gt $sym_size ]]; then 156 echo "skipping $func address at $addr due to size mismatch ($offset > $sym_size)" 165 echo "$func+$offset/$sym_size:"
|
D | insert-sys-cert.c | 63 unsigned long offset; member 82 unsigned long offset = x[i].sh_offset; in get_offset_from_address() local 85 return addr - start + offset; in get_offset_from_address() 101 s->offset = 0; in get_symbol_from_map() 128 s->offset = get_offset_from_address(hdr, s->address); in get_symbol_from_map() 130 s->content = (void *)hdr + s->offset; in get_symbol_from_map() 168 s->offset = 0; in get_symbol_from_table() 178 s->offset = s->address - sec->sh_addr in get_symbol_from_table() 181 s->content = (void *)hdr + s->offset; in get_symbol_from_table() 265 info("offset: 0x%lx\n", (unsigned long)s->offset); in print_sym() [all …]
|
D | recordmcount.c | 113 ulseek(int const fd, off_t const offset, int const whence) in ulseek() argument 117 file_ptr = file_map + offset; in ulseek() 120 file_ptr += offset; in ulseek() 123 file_ptr = file_map + (sb.st_size - offset); in ulseek() 198 static int (*make_nop)(void *map, size_t const offset); 200 static int make_nop_x86(void *map, size_t const offset) in make_nop_x86() argument 206 ptr = map + offset; in make_nop_x86() 210 op = map + offset - 1; in make_nop_x86() 215 ulseek(fd_map, offset - 1, SEEK_SET); in make_nop_x86() 240 static int make_nop_arm(void *map, size_t const offset) in make_nop_arm() argument [all …]
|
D | kallsyms.c | 389 long long offset; in write_src() local 393 offset = table[i].addr - relative_base; in write_src() 394 overflow = (offset < 0 || offset > UINT_MAX); in write_src() 396 offset = table[i].addr; in write_src() 397 overflow = (offset < 0 || offset > INT_MAX); in write_src() 399 offset = relative_base - table[i].addr - 1; in write_src() 400 overflow = (offset < INT_MIN || offset >= 0); in write_src() 409 printf("\t.long\t%#x\n", (int)offset); in write_src()
|
D | recordmcount.pl | 430 my $offset = 0; # offset of ref_func to section beginning 468 printf FILE "\t%s %s + %d\n", $type, $ref_func, $cur_offset - $offset; 525 $offset = hex $1; 533 $offset = hex $1;
|
D | extract_xc3028.pl | 46 my ($offset, $length) = @_; 49 sysseek(INFILE, $offset, SEEK_SET); 104 my ($offset, $length) = @_; 105 my $out = get_hunk($offset, $length); 119 my ($offset, $length) = @_; 120 my $out = get_hunk($offset, $length);
|
D | Makefile.kasan | 14 -fasan-shadow-offset=$(KASAN_SHADOW_OFFSET) \
|
/scripts/dtc/ |
D | treesource.c | 72 while (m && (m->offset == 0)) { in write_propval_string() 112 while (m && (m->offset <= (i + 1))) { in write_propval_string() 114 assert(m->offset == (i+1)); in write_propval_string() 132 assert (m->offset == val.len); in write_propval_string() 145 while (m && (m->offset <= ((char *)cp - val.val))) { in write_propval_cells() 147 assert(m->offset == ((char *)cp - val.val)); in write_propval_cells() 161 assert (m->offset == val.len); in write_propval_cells() 175 while (m && (m->offset == (bp-val.val))) { in write_propval_bytes() 189 assert (m->offset == val.len); in write_propval_bytes() 217 if ((m->offset > 0) && (prop->val.val[m->offset - 1] != '\0')) in write_propval() [all …]
|
D | util.c | 234 off_t bufsize = 1024, offset = 0; in utilfdt_read_err_len() local 248 if (offset == bufsize) { in utilfdt_read_err_len() 253 ret = read(fd, &buf[offset], bufsize - offset); in utilfdt_read_err_len() 258 offset += ret; in utilfdt_read_err_len() 301 int offset; in utilfdt_write_err() local 312 offset = 0; in utilfdt_write_err() 314 while (offset < totalsize) { in utilfdt_write_err() 315 ret = write(fd, ptr + offset, totalsize - offset); in utilfdt_write_err() 320 offset += ret; in utilfdt_write_err()
|
D | data.c | 132 memmove(d.val + m->offset + len, d.val + m->offset, d.len - m->offset); in data_insert_at_marker() 133 memcpy(d.val + m->offset, p, len); in data_insert_at_marker() 139 m->offset += len; in data_insert_at_marker() 163 m2->offset += d1.len; in data_merge() 245 m->offset = d.len; in data_add_marker()
|
D | fdtput.c | 168 int node, offset = 0; in create_paths() local 174 for (sep = path; *sep; path = sep + 1, offset = node) { in create_paths() 180 node = fdt_subnode_offset_namelen(blob, offset, path, in create_paths() 183 node = fdt_add_subnode_namelen(blob, offset, path, in create_paths()
|
D | flattree.c | 124 static void emit_offset_label(FILE *f, const char *label, int offset) in emit_offset_label() argument 127 fprintf(f, "%s\t= . + %d\n", label, offset); in emit_offset_label() 171 emit_offset_label(f, m->ref, m->offset); in asm_emit_data() 659 static char *flat_read_stringtable(struct inbuf *inb, int offset) in flat_read_stringtable() argument 663 p = inb->base + offset; in flat_read_stringtable() 667 offset); in flat_read_stringtable() 675 return xstrdup(inb->base + offset); in flat_read_stringtable()
|
D | checks.c | 420 assert(m->offset == 0); in check_phandle_prop() 529 assert(m->offset + sizeof(cell_t) <= prop->val.len); in fixup_phandle_references() 537 *((fdt32_t *)(prop->val.val + m->offset)) = in fixup_phandle_references() 543 *((fdt32_t *)(prop->val.val + m->offset)) = cpu_to_fdt32(phandle); in fixup_phandle_references() 562 assert(m->offset <= prop->val.len); in fixup_path_references()
|
/scripts/gdb/linux/ |
D | cpus.py | 40 offset = gdb.parse_and_eval( 44 offset = gdb.parse_and_eval( 48 offset = 0 49 pointer = var_ptr.cast(utils.get_long_type()) + offset
|
/scripts/mod/ |
D | sumversion.c | 201 const unsigned int offset = mctx->byte_count & 0x3f; in md4_final_ascii() local 202 char *p = (char *)mctx->block + offset; in md4_final_ascii() 203 int padding = 56 - (offset + 1); in md4_final_ascii() 456 unsigned long offset) in write_version() argument 467 if (lseek(fd, offset, SEEK_SET) == (off_t)-1) { in write_version() 469 filename, offset, strerror(errno)); in write_version()
|
/scripts/kconfig/ |
D | nconf.c | 368 int offset = 1; in print_function_line() local 374 mvwprintw(main_window, lines-3, offset, in print_function_line() 378 offset += strlen(function_keys[i].key_str); in print_function_line() 380 offset, "%s", in print_function_line() 382 offset += strlen(function_keys[i].func) + skip; in print_function_line()
|
D | mconf.c | 371 if (pos->offset >= start && pos->offset < end) { in update_text() 385 memcpy(buf + pos->offset, header, sizeof(header) - 1); in update_text()
|
/scripts/coccinelle/iterators/ |
D | use_after_iter.cocci | 2 /// variable ends up pointing to an address at an offset from the list head,
|